Section 16 of Arlington National Cemetery, on a low rise west of the visitor center, where the concentric circles of grave markers radiate outward from a circular grassy clearing. Until December 20, 2023, a thirty-two-foot bronze stood in the clearing, a figure of the South looking south, surrounded by thirty-two life-size figures sculpted by Moses Ezekiel in his Rome studio. Then a crane from a Virginia contractor that had also dismantled the Lee statues in Richmond and Charlottesville lifted the bronze off its base and trucked it away. The granite stayed because moving it would have disturbed nearby graves. By 2027 a new bronze is expected to stand there again.</p>
